In "A Brief Commentary on the Apocalypse," Sylvester Bliss provides a penetrating analysis of the Book of Revelation, drawing upon a rich tapestry of theological insights and historical contexts. Bliss employs a lucid and accessible literary style, making complex eschatological themes graspable for both lay readers and scholars alike. His commentary not only unpacks the symbolic language of John'Äôs apocalyptic vision but also situates it within the socio-political milieu of early Christianity, thereby illuminating the challenges faced by persecuted believers of that era. Through meticulous examination, Bliss reverently explores the intersections of prophecy, morality, and divine justice, offering readers a comprehensive understanding of this enigmatic scriptural text. Sylvester Bliss was a prominent figure in 19th-century American theology, deeply influenced by the revivalist movements of his time and a keen interest in biblical prophecies. His background in the Congregationalist church and his commitment to empowering believers through knowledge further fueled his desire to write this commentary. By synthesizing scholarly rigor with pastoral sensitivity, Bliss sought to provide a guide that would bolster faith and understanding amidst the tumultuous events unfolding in his contemporary world. I highly recommend "A Brief Commentary on the Apocalypse" to anyone intrigued by biblical literature, eschatology, or the interplay between faith and socio-political struggles. This work not only enhances one's understanding of the Book of Revelation but also invites personal reflection on the implications of its themes in today's world, making it a timeless resource for both devotional study and academic inquiry.
